Understanding the Editor's Contribution to Your Book
Your book's journey to publication isn't complete without a skilled editor's assistance . Many creators believe the editor's function is simply to correct typos and grammar errors , but their influence is far greater than that. A good editor gives a fresh viewpoint on your manuscript, helping you notice plot gaps , strengthen hero development, and refine your overall narrative . They guarantee your voice shines through while improving the book's clarity , ultimately enhancing its appeal to readers . Consider their feedback carefully; it’s a critical expenditure in your book's achievement.

Hybrid Publishing vs. Traditional: What's the Difference?
The landscape of literary distribution has seen a considerable shift. Traditionally, creators relied on well-known publishers to handle every aspect of getting their work into the grasp of audiences . However, hybrid release offers an different route . It combines elements of both – authors retain more control over their literary undertaking and royalties while also benefiting from expert support like editing , design creation and promotion . Ultimately, the decision between traditional and hybrid publishing depends on an creator's goals and preferences .
